2005 Alfa Romeo 156 vs. 2009 Kia Optima
To start off, 2009 Kia Optima is newer by 4 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Alfa Romeo 156.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Alfa Romeo 156 would be higher. At 2,399 cc (4 cylinders), 2009 Kia Optima is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Kia Optima (173 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 35 more horse power than 2005 Alfa Romeo 156. (138 HP @ 6500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2009 Kia Optima should accelerate faster than 2005 Alfa Romeo 156.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Kia Optima (169 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 6 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Alfa Romeo 156. (163 Nm @ 3900 RPM). This means 2009 Kia Optima will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Alfa Romeo 156.
